73rd British National Ploughing Championships & Country Festival | 12th & 13th October 2024 | Thoresby Estate, near Ollerton, Nottinghamshire, NG22 9EQ.

Around 250 top ploughmen and women from all over Great Britain will compete at the 73rd British National Ploughing Championships which will be held on the Thoresby Estate, near Ollerton, Nottinghamshire by kind permission of Thoresby Farming.

Two busy days – Saturday and Sunday, October 12th and 13th – will be packed with competitions for many types of plough and styles of ploughing, the highpoint of which will be when the British Champions are crowned and the top competitors are selected to represent England at the 2025 World and European Ploughing Championships.

There will be a total of fifteen different ploughing classes over the two days plus in six of these classes, the top 10 competitors from the first day will take part in a ‘Plough-Off Final’ on the Sunday to find the British Champion in each section. In total, there will be around 300 ploughing plots ploughed over the two days!

It is an excellent site and there will be plenty of free car parking spaces.

There will be something for everyone alongside the ploughing competitions, from steam ploughing engines; vintage tractors and machinery displays; manufacturers and local dealers demonstrating the latest farm equipment available; agricultural trade stands; shopping stalls and country crafts.

Horse ploughing is always one of the major attractions and we expect to see a dozen or more pairs of heavy horses at work each day. Magnificently turned out with ornate brass and leather harness, these true farm ‘workhorses’ will be seen competing to produce the best general purpose ploughing on the first day and the stylish traditional ‘high cut’ work on the second day.
